La compilación de desarrollo de Tab Mix Plus WebExtension ya está disponible

El autor del popular complemento de Firefox Tab Mix Plus lanzó ayer la primera versión de la próxima versión de Tab Mix Plus basada en WebExtensions.

La extensión está disponible bajo una nueva URL en la tienda de complementos de Mozilla para separar el complemento clásico del nuevo.

La extensión es una reescritura completa del complemento heredado utilizando el nuevo sistema WebExtensions que admite Firefox. Mozilla dejó de admitir el sistema de complemento clásico en Firefox 57 Stable.

Tab Mix Plus WebExtension primer vistazo

La única funcionalidad que ofrece la primera versión de desarrollo de Tab Mix Plus WebExtension es la funcionalidad Enlaces. Puede usarlo para controlar enlaces y solo para el comportamiento de apertura de enlaces.

Es necesario modificar varias preferencias sobre about: config para gran parte de la funcionalidad proporcionada ya que WebExtensions ya no puede modificar las preferencias existentes de Firefox.

Las opciones de la extensión enumeran cinco preferencias de Firefox que los usuarios deben modificar para desbloquear todas las opciones disponibles.

Una vez hecho esto, se proporcionan las siguientes opciones:

  • Abra los enlaces que se abren en una nueva ventana en: nueva pestaña, nueva ventana, pestaña actual.
  • Utilice preferencias separadas para enlaces de otras aplicaciones.
  • Restricciones de JavaScript y ventanas emergentes: permite cambiar el tamaño de las ventanas emergentes, abrir todas las ventanas emergentes en pestañas, permitir todas las ventanas emergentes.
  • Abre pestañas con clics medios.
  • Inicie las descargas con Alt-Click.
  • Evite pestañas en blanco cuando descargue archivos.
  • Fuerza para abrir en una nueva pestaña: todos los enlaces, enlaces a otros sitios.
  • Abrir enlaces con un atributo de destino en la pestaña actual.
  • Abra enlaces con destino al marco existente en la pestaña actual.

El modo de ventana única aún no está implementado. WebExtension carece de soporte para eventos, sesiones, mouse, pantalla y funcionalidad de menú.

Palabras de clausura

El lanzamiento es una versión de desarrollo temprana y los usuarios de Tab Mix Plus aún no deberían tener esperanzas, ya que carece de casi toda la funcionalidad del complemento heredado.

El autor de Tab Mix Plus es retenido por las API faltantes de WebExtensions. Muchas características de la versión heredada de Tab Mix Plus simplemente no son compatibles con las API de WebExtension.

Si bien algunas API ya existen, otras aún están en desarrollo o aún no han sido decididas por Mozilla. Se pide a los usuarios de Tab Mix Plus que voten por los errores en el sitio web de seguimiento de errores Bugzilla de Mozilla.

Aún así, el lanzamiento de la versión basada en WebExtensions de Tab Mix Plus es una señal de vida. Si bien no está claro si la versión de WebExtensions de Tab Mix Plus admitirá toda la funcionalidad del complemento heredado, parece que el desarrollador de la extensión lanzará una versión estable de WebExtensions eventualmente.

Ahora usted : ¿Cree que en el futuro se lanzará una versión completa de Tab Mix Plus basada en WebExtension?

Artículos relacionados:

  • Firefox solo admitirá WebExtensions para fines de 2017
  • Mozilla auditó Tab Mix Plus para compatibilidad con WebExtensions
  • Mozilla: WebExtensions son excelentes para desarrolladores
  • Extensión Tab Mix Plus Firefox